Eighth Annual Toy of the Year Awards
The Toy of the Year Awards kicked off this year’s Toy Fair Week on Saturday, February 16, 2008. Celebrating the best in toys, they were honored at Pier 60/Chelsea Piers in New York. Hundreds of toy industry retailers and leaders attended the event, beginning the 105th Toy Fair which had over 35,000 registered attendees.
The TOTY Awards celebrate the success, creativity, and fun spirit of the toy industry by honoring toys developed by the international toy industry for North American consumers. The Toy Industry Association has vocalized their commitment to honoring companies and individuals who utilize imagination and ingenuity in the production of toys. And the winners are:
- Toy of the Year was given to Spin Master, Ltd’s Air Hogs Havoc Heli Laser Battle
- Most Innovative Toy of the Year went to Fisher-Price for their Smart Cycle Physical Learning
- Infant/Preschool Toy of the Year was given to Spin Master Ltd. For the Moon Sand Adventure Island
- Electronic Entertainment Toy of the Year went to Tiger Electronics for the Power Tour Electric Guitar
- Educational Toy of the Year was given to Fisher-Price’s Smart Cycle Physical Learning
- Activity Toy of the Year went to LEGO Systems, Inc. for their LEGO City
- Game of the Year went to Techno Source’s Rubik’s Revolution
- Specialty Toy of the Year was given to Elenco for their Snap Circuits
- Outdoor Toy of the Year went to RipStik USA for the RipStik Caster Board
- Girl Toy of the Year was awarded to Hasbro, Inc. for their Littlest Pet Shop: Display & Play Round & Round Pet Town Playset and Manhattan Toy’s Troop Groovy Girls
- Boy Toy of the Year was given to Hasbro, Inc. for their Transformers Movie Deluxe Figures
- Property of the Year was awarded to Disney Consumer Products for their licensed property Hannah Montana
